Section 02

Pricing & contracts.

From $15,000. Full launches typically $25,000–$150,000.

From $15,000. Full launches typically $25,000–$150,000. Multi-channel launches typically sit between $25,000 and $80,000. Full-service Build + Launch + Grow engagements for flagship hardware, healthtech or future tech products typically run $80,000 to $150,000+. Ongoing retainers for paid media, email and Shopify run $8,000 to $25,000 per month plus ad spend. No hourly billing.
$15,000 minimum project fee. We do not take engagements under that threshold because the setup overhead (kickoff, strategy, access provisioning, documentation) outweighs the value that can be delivered.
No. Agency fees cover strategy, creative, execution, optimisation and reporting. Media budget is separate and paid directly to platforms. Typical media budget: paid launches start at $10,000 per month and scale to $100,000+ per month as the business scales.
Project fees are the default. Performance-based structures (revenue share, CPA-based fees, commission on funding) are available case-by-case for clients with a trackable conversion relationship and historical performance data. Performance structures are rare and not offered at first engagement.
Rarely. Equity is considered only for long-term operational clients where Blazon is effectively embedded as a growth function. Not offered at first engagement. Most engagements are fee-based.
Yes. Standard payment structure for launch projects: 40% at kickoff, 30% at mid-project milestone, 30% on delivery. Retainers are billed monthly in advance. Custom payment schedules considered case-by-case for enterprise clients.
Three-month minimum initial term. Month-to-month after that. We do not lock clients into long contracts. If we are not delivering value, we expect the relationship to end.
No exit fees on project engagements. Retainers can be cancelled with 30 days' notice after the three-month minimum. If a project is cancelled mid-delivery, completed milestones are billed at the pro-rated fee.
Yes, with scoping realism. Pre-revenue startups without external funding can engage on smaller defined projects ($15,000 to $40,000 range). Pre-revenue startups with seed funding typically engage on full-service launches. We do not take equity-only engagements and we do not do pro-bono work.

Section 07

Working with us.

Three stages. Strategy Call (30 minutes, free) to pressure-test fit. Scoping Call (60 minutes, optional) to align on objectives and deliverables. Written proposal delivered within 5 business days of scoping. Kickoff within 2 weeks of proposal sign-off.
Four-hour kickoff session covering product deep dive, buyer definition, commercial targets, competitive landscape, brand context, success criteria. Followed by one week of internal strategy work, then a second session to align on the written launch plan.
Three phases: Build (6-24 weeks), Launch (30-45 days for crowdfunding, variable for DTC and SaaS), Grow (12-24+ months). Each phase has defined deliverables, KPIs and exit criteria. See our process for full detail.
Yes. Every engagement has a named Strategy Lead, Campaign Manager, and specialist leads for each in-scope channel. Core team stable for the duration of the engagement.
Weekly 60-minute project call as standard. Daily Slack for rapid communication. Pre-launch and launch weeks increase to daily stand-ups. Monthly strategic review for retainer clients.
Live Looker Studio dashboards for paid media, email, Shopify and campaign performance. Weekly written status updates. Monthly executive summaries with strategic commentary. Client has direct access to all underlying accounts (Klaviyo, Meta, Google, Shopify).
The client. Every asset produced during the engagement (creative files, video, photography, documentation) belongs to the client. Source files delivered at engagement end or on request during the engagement.
